Senkos ARE the hot bait all over right now and I did manage to get some of the newest colors that are not even mentioned in the Yama. catalog. That fish you picked up while the bait was sinking was not a oddball, Brian, that has been the hot ticket for suspended and crusing fish, just a dead fall with a twitch or two until it hits the bottom. then twitch it up again and let it fall. These baits are heavy enough to fish them pretty deep where they can also be fished as a soft jerk bait, only unlike a Fluke that has to be fished with weight they have incredible action as they are fished with no lead, and as you noticed they don't stick in the weeds.
